18,000 years ago, the first inhabitants migrated from Asia to North America in quest of food and new lands where animals would abound. An interactive experience of an unheard-of wealth, this exploration allows you to travel the migratory routes of the ancestors who populated North America. You will feel as if you were reliving the climate changes that provoked their migration. You will get to know the life habits of the Peoples of the Ice, as well as their dwellings, their history and their capacity to adapt to the New World. Thanks to skillful thematic reconstructions – camps, clothing, tools, etc. – you will relive the history of this important migration from 18 000 years ago to now.
The 5.5 km.- long trip is easy and can be carried out on board the electric shuttle.
